The Minstrel Boy will return, we pray
Language: English
The Minstrel Boy will return, we pray; When we hear the news, we all will cheer it, The minstrel boy will return one day, Torn perhaps in body, not in spirit. Then may he play on his harp in peace, In a world such as Heaven intended, For all the bitterness of man must cease, And ev'ry battle must be ended.
About the headline (FAQ)
Written during the American Civil War as a third verse for The Minstrel Boy.Authorship:
